Why Your Hip Hurts (and When It Needs Treatment)

Sometimes hip pain strikes after an accident, while other times it develops gradually. Some of the typical causes include:

  • Arthritis (osteoarthritis or rheumatoid): degeneration of cartilage in the hip joint, leading to stiffness and pain.
  • Bursitis: the small fluid-filled sacs that cushion your hip get irritated.
  • Tendonitis: tendons become inflamed from overuse, causing hip pain.
  • Hip impingement & labral tear: when the hip bones rub abnormally, leading to damage or a torn labrum.
  • Muscle strains & sports injuries: common injuries from athletics or training that stress the hip.
  • Fractures or dislocations: serious injuries that happen most often in accidents or older adults.
  • Avascular necrosis: blocked blood flow leads to collapse of hip bone structure.
  • Referred pain: issues such as sciatica or a slipped disc that cause pain in the hip area.
  • Hip dysplasia: misalignment of the hip socket that causes chronic discomfort.

When Is Hip Pain a Serious Problem?

Use this quick guide. Contact a therapist or doctor as soon as possible if you have:

  • Constant pain that fails to ease up with typical self-care
  • Difficulty standing or walking without the hip collapsing
  • Hip feels hot, swollen, or looks red and irritated
  • Numbness, tingling, or sudden weakness in the leg
  • Hip pain after a fall, sports collision, or car accident

Even if the pain isn’t severe, recurring discomfort that interferes with work, exercise, or family activities should be checked out. Getting help sooner makes recovery easier and reduces the risk of complications.

Home Tips to Feel Better Now

  • Alternate heat and ice: switch between ice for swelling and heat for stiffness as needed.
  • Micro-breaks: give your hips relief by standing or moving often during the day.
  • Sleep setup: position pillows to ease strain whether you sleep on your back or side.
  • Activity pacing: tackle daily chores in smaller sessions to prevent flare-ups.
  • Walk smart: short, frequent walks usually beat a single long walk early on.

These tips help, but the fastest progress comes from a plan matched to your specific cause.
